This little thing is based on a German candy called "Lakritzschnecke" and another one called "Happy Cherries". "Lakritzschnecken" are licorice candies that I grew up with. Unrolling and dividing it (without to split up the end) will leave you with a long cord of licorice. Delicious, fun to "play" with... childhood memories. This thing is just a little joke that I invested little time in to get it out of my system. I've included the Fusion 360 files, but they're not pretty. But I think you shouldn't be doing things like that in Fusion 360 anyway. I don't have a MMU so I couldn't test the print. The non-MMU version includes a simplified "Lakritzschnecke" and you've to paint the details of the eyes and parts have to be glued together. The parts are just to small to be printed reliably.
